导读:Redis是一种基于内存的数据结构存储系统,它支持多种数据结构,如字符串、哈希表、列表、集合和有序集合等 。Redis服务器缓存可以提高网站性能 , 减少数据库访问次数,本文将介绍Redis服务器缓存的相关知识 。
1. Redis服务器缓存的概念
Redis服务器缓存是指将部分数据缓存在Redis服务器中,以减少对数据库的访问,提高网站性能 。当用户请求数据时,先从Redis服务器中获?。绻挥性虼邮菘庵谢袢? ,然后将数据存入Redis服务器中,以便下次使用 。
2. Redis服务器缓存的优点
a. 提高网站性能:Redis服务器缓存能够减少数据库访问次数,提高网站性能 。
b. 减轻数据库压力:Redis服务器缓存能够将部分数据缓存在Redis服务器中,减轻数据库的负担 。
c. 支持多种数据结构:Redis支持多种数据结构 , 能够满足不同场景的需求 。
3. Redis服务器缓存的应用场景
a. 网站首页:网站首页通常包含大量静态数据,将这些数据缓存在Redis服务器中能够提高网站性能 。
b. 商品详情页:商品详情页通常包含商品信息、评论等数据,将这些数据缓存在Redis服务器中能够减少数据库访问次数 。
c. 购物车:将用户的购物车信息缓存在Redis服务器中能够提高网站性能,同时减轻数据库压力 。
4. Redis服务器缓存的注意事项
a. 缓存数据要考虑过期时间,避免数据过期而不被更新 。
b. 缓存数据要考虑内存限制,避免因为缓存数据过多导致Redis服务器崩溃 。
c. 缓存数据要考虑并发访问,避免数据竞争问题 。
【redis客户端清理缓存 清redis服务器缓存】总结:Redis服务器缓存能够提高网站性能,减少数据库访问次数,但需要注意缓存数据的过期时间、内存限制和并发访问问题 。
推荐阅读
- redis缓存有什么作用 redis缓存永久有效
- 如何选择适合自己的战意服务器? 战意服务器怎么选
- 如何设置马来西亚服务器? 马来西亚服务器怎么设置
- mysql 导出数据表 mysql记录导出
- mysql关键表查询 mysql查看表关联表
- mysql8源码安装 安装mysqlyum源
- mysql里text类型
- mysql查询出现次数并筛选 mysql查询列筛选重复
- 怎么进mysql数据库 如何进入mysql数据库